Articles of android

Widgets reagieren nicht, wenn sie erneut über Code hinzugefügt werden

Ich arbeite an einem Werfer. Es erlaubt Benutzern, Widgets aus der Liste hinzuzufügen, es funktioniert gut. Ich speichere Informationen über das Widget (Paketname, classnname und seine Koordinaten auf dem Bildschirm) in meiner database, wenn der Benutzer einen zum Bildschirm hinzufügt. Wenn die Anwendung neu gestartet wird (oder das Gerät selbst), füge ich diese (vom Benutzer […]

Android: Tastatur überschneidet sich mit dem EditText (mit Printscreens)

Ich habe einen EditText (in den der Benutzer Zahlen eingeben kann). Wenn der Benutzer auf das EditText-Textfeld klickt, wird eine Tastatur mit Zahlen geöffnet. Wie Sie sehen können, verbirgt die Tastatur einen kleinen Teil des Textfelds. Aber wenn ich eine Taste zum Beispiel 0 drücke, sieht es gut aus. Gibt es etwas, was ich tun […]

Abrufen des Pixelfarbwerts eines Punkts in einer Android-Ansicht mit einem Bitmap-unterstützten Canvas

Ich versuche herauszufinden, wie der Pixelfarbwert an einem bestimmten Punkt in einer Ansicht am besten ermittelt werden kann. Es gibt drei Möglichkeiten, wie ich in die Ansicht schreibe: Ich stelle ein Hintergrundbild mit View.setBackgroundDrawable (…) . Ich schreibe Text, zeichne Linien usw. mit Canvas.drawText (…) , Canvas.drawLine (…) usw. in einen Bitmap-unterstützten Canvas . Ich […]

Capture Button-Freigabe in Android

Ist es möglich, die Freigabe einer Schaltfläche zu erfassen, wenn wir den Klick mit onClickListener() und OnClick() ? Ich möchte die Größe einer Schaltfläche erhöhen, wenn sie gedrückt wird, und sie auf die ursprüngliche Größe zurücksetzen, wenn der Klick aufgehoben wird. Kann mir jemand helfen wie ich das mache?

Es wurde keine Ressourcen-ID für das Attribut ‘Layout_Behavior’ im Paket gefunden

Meine Anwendung funktionierte einwandfrei, bis ich versuchte, eine Bibliothek hinzuzufügen. Nachdem ich die Bibliothek hinzugefügt habe, gibt Android Studio den folgenden Fehler aus: Fehler: (26) Kein Ressourcenbezeichner für Attribut ‘Layout_Behavior’ im Paket ‘inf ..’ gefunden Dies ist meine build.gradle Datei: dependencies { compile fileTree(dir: ‘libs’, include: [‘*.jar’]) compile ‘com.android.support:appcompat-v7:23.0.1’ compile ‘com.android.support:support-v4:23.0.1’ compile ‘com.ogaclejapan.smarttablayout:utils-v4:1.3.0@aar’ compile ‘com.ogaclejapan.smarttablayout:library:1.3.0@aar’ […]

Aktualisieren Sie die SQL-database mit ContentValues ​​und der Update-Methode

Ich möchte meine SQL-Lite-database mit der nativen Update-Methode der SQLiteDatabase-class von Android aktualisieren. ContentValues dataToInsert = new ContentValues(); dataToInsert.put(“name”, “flo”); dataToInsert.put(“location”, “flotown”); String where = “id” + “=” + id; try{ db.update(DATABASE_TABLE, dataToInsert, where, null); } catch (Exception e){ String error = e.getMessage().toString(); } aber ich bekomme folgenden Fehler: android.database.sqlite.SQLiteException: in der Nähe von “15”: […]

Wie man eine .csv auf Android erstellt

Mein Ziel ist es, eine .csv-Datei aus einer Tabelle zu erstellen, um einen Bericht zu drucken. Ich kann diese CSV-Datei dann in meiner SD-Karte speichern. Ich habe auf einige ähnliche Fragen hingewiesen, aber sie bitten darum, dass eine JAR-Datei vorhanden ist. Gibt es einen anderen Weg, ohne eine JAR-Datei zu integrieren? Habe eine jar Datei […]

Wie sende ich E-Mails in Android?

Wie sendet man eine einfache E-Mail-Nachricht in Code auf Android?

Android: notifyDataSetChanged (); funktioniert nicht

Ich habe eine database in einem Server und von einem Tablet nehme ich einige Werte aus einer Tabelle in der database. Ich lade diese Informationen korrekt in eine Liste, aber ich würde gerne wissen, warum bei einer Änderung nichts passiert, selbst wenn ich notifyDataSetChanged(); . Ich muss sagen, dass zum Laden der Ladedaten verwenden Sie […]

Android: Starten einer Aktivität für eine andere Drittanbieter-App

Ich arbeite an einer App und möchte die Last.fm-App darin integrieren. Wenn jemand einen Künstler in meiner App anschaut, möchte ich einen Button haben, den er antippen kann, um die Last.fm-Anwendung mit den Informationen des Künstlers zu öffnen. Diese Absicht funktioniert, aber es lädt ein Menü mit der Frage, welche App ich verwenden möchte (Browser […]